Pfaffenhoffen (German: Pfaffenhofen) is a former commune in the Bas-Rhin department in Alsace-Champagne-Ardenne-Lorraine in north-eastern France. On 1 January 2016, it was merged into the new commune Val-de-Moder.[1]
